Programs of Study Related to Pre-Professional Health Studies

Bachelor of Science in Allied Health
This major will prepare you for graduate study in areas such as physical therapy, occupational therapy, physician’s assistant, nutrition and exercise science. You will develop expertise in human movement and human movement dysfunction. Allied health professionals may have direct or indirect contact with patients and be responsible for preparing and operating equipment, recording and reporting on patient response to treatment, assessing patient needs or analyzing data.

Bachelor of Science in Biochemistry and Molecular Biology
This major will prepare you for application to medical, dental, pharmacy and veterinary schools, as well as graduate study in the sciences. This major examines life at the molecular level using basic tools from chemistry and biology to dissect how organisms, cells and molecules function. Although a rigorous major, you will have the flexibility to tailor it to your interests, and you will be  required to complete a research project.

Bachelor of Science in Biology
This major will prepare you for application to medical, dental, pharmacy, veterinary, optometry and nurse practitioner schools, as well as graduate study in the sciences. The major provides you with a solid foundation in biology, as well as the opportunity to take  specialized courses in more advanced fields. You will also be  encouraged to participate in research projects and internships, and have the opportunity to take field and international travel courses.

Bachelor of Science in Chemistry
This major will prepare you for application to medical, dental and pharmacy schools, as well as graduate study in the sciences. Approved by the American Chemical Society (ACS), this major provides you with a broad and rigorous chemistry education to give you the intellectual, experimental and communication skills to become an effective scientific professional. You will gain hands-on experience with state-of-the-art instrumentation and have the opportunity to participate in research projects with faculty.

Equine Pre-Veterinary/Pre-Graduate Studies
This major allows you to meet the requirements for entry to graduate programs and colleges of veterinary medicine, as well as gain valuable hands-on experience working with horses at Otterbein’s Austin E. Knowlton Center for Equine Science.
